Hey, welcome to the rotation! Quick heads-up on Terraquill, our field-survey app. Offline mode is the thing that pages most often: surveyors in low-signal areas queue submissions locally, and the sync worker flushes them when connectivity returns. If the queue backs up past 500 entries, you'll get an alert — usually it's a stale auth token, not data loss. Don't panic, don't purge the queue. The full troubleshooting guide for offline sync lives on the internal wiki here:

wiki page, tahaf-tajog: https://jira.ordindyn.corp/pipeline

For the incoming director. We are moving the Claredge product base from monthly to annual billing. Pilot cohort converted at 62%; churn unchanged. Outstanding items: revenue-recognition treatment with the auditors, dunning logic rebuild, and pricing for legacy accounts in the Northgale territory. Target: full rollout within two quarters. Finance owns the deferred-revenue schedule; Ops owns invoicing cutover. Weekly steering calls continue. Escalate slippage immediately. The confidential note on wider business plans is appended directly below.

management briefing: Project Juleth slips by two quarters because of the audit delay.

Handover: audio waveform preview (Larkspool SDK). To external plugin authors — the preview renderer now downsamples to 2000 peaks client-side; please do not request full-resolution PCM, as the old endpoint is deprecated. Peak data is cached per asset and invalidated on re-upload. Edge cases around very short clips (<0.5s) are documented in the renderer notes. The signing keystore for plugin builds unlocks with the recovery passphrase below.

unlock words, yawig-kagef: gordor-holvan-ulaael-pramir-ulaiel-tamdor